What types of projects and responsibilities can a web developer with an associate degree typically expect?

Web developers with an associate degree often work on building and maintaining websites, implementing updates, troubleshooting technical issues, and ensuring a consistent user experience across devices. Responsibilities may include coding new web pages, optimizing site performance, collaborating with designers, and integrating backend services. Depending on the company size and team structure, you might also be involved in client meetings or cross-departmental projects. These diverse tasks help you develop a broad skill set and provide valuable experience for future growth in more advanced or specialized roles.

What is a web developer with associate degree?

A Web Developer with an associate degree is responsible for designing, coding, and maintaining websites and web applications. They work with programming languages like HTML, CSS, JavaScript, and databases to create functional and visually appealing sites. While an associate degree provides foundational knowledge, employers may also look for hands-on experience or certifications. These developers often collaborate with designers and back-end developers to ensure seamless functionality. Entry-level roles may include front-end development, back-end development, or full-stack development.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the web developer with associate degree position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Web Developer with an Associate Degree, you need a solid understanding of HTML, CSS, JavaScript, and responsive web design, as well as a foundational background in computer science principles. Familiarity with web frameworks, version control systems like Git, and sometimes industry certifications such as CIW or CompTIA IT Fundamentals can be advantageous. Problem-solving ability, attention to detail, and effective communication make candidates stand out in collaborative, deadline-driven environments. These capabilities are crucial for delivering user-friendly, functional websites that meet client and business needs.

Job Title: Manufacturing Engineer- Fabrication

Department: Engineering

FLSA Status: Exempt


About the Role:

The Fabrication Manufacturing Engineer is responsible for New Part Introduction (NPI) & process optimization of sheet metal, tube frame, welded components and large assemblies. This involves reviewing customer drawings & CAD models to ensure tolerances match process capability and providing Design for Manufacturability (DFM) feedback to the customer. The engineer will work across functional departments such as Estimating, Customer Service, Production, Quality & Sales to support NPI. In addition to NPI this role will help improve existing processes on the shop floor to reduce cycle times, scrap or improve organization. This position will work in an Aerospace environment meeting AS9100 quality standards & in a fabrication shop that is CMMC 2.0 certified.

Minimum Qualifications:

  • Bachelor or associate’s degree in mechanical engineering, manufacturing Engineering, or a related field. Experience may be substituted in lieu of an engineering degree
  • Understanding of sheet metal fabrication equipment or the willingness to spend time on the manufacturing floor to learn these processes hands on
  • Proficiency with CAD software for part modeling & engineering drawings
  • Strong computer skills with proficiency in all windows based programs
  • Knowledge of quality control methodologies and manufacturing safety standards

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Experience using Solidworks for CAD, Trumpf/Amada software for programming fabrication equipment, Miller Intellipath for programming welding robots & Paperless Parts for quoting
  • Experience working in an AS9100 & CMMC 2.0 environment
  • Hands-on experience with punch/laser combos, press brakes, robotic welding & powder coating
  • Experience working directly with customers for DFM
  • Knowledge of how to use Enterprise Resource Planning (ERP) systems
  • Familiarity with Lean Manufacturing and Six Sigma principles
  • Knowledge of scripting languages like Python

Responsibilities:

  • Support NPI to meet customer deadlines by preparing customer files for production in the form of process models & drawings
  • Spending time on the manufacturing floor producing first time runs directly with production for large assemblies
  • Specifying & ordering tooling for forming & punching operations
  • Designing fixtures for robotic or manual welding & programming welding robots
  • Supporting process improvement on the production floor
  • Conduct root cause analysis and implement corrective actions for defects or process deviations.
  • Lead continuous improvement projects focused on reducing cycle times and scrap.
  • Ensure compliance with safety regulations and quality standards throughout the manufacturing process.

Skills:

The Fabrication Manufacturing Engineer utilizes technical skills in CAD software daily for solid modeling & engineering drawing creation. Strong analytical skills are essential for troubleshooting production issues and implementing effective solutions that enhance quality and efficiency. Communication skills are critical when collaborating with cross-functional teams and training production personnel on new procedures. Knowledge of Lean and Six Sigma methodologies supports continuous improvement efforts to reduce waste and improve cycle times
